The TPS62510DRC from Texas Instruments is a high-efficiency synchronous step-down DC-DC converter optimized for battery-powered applications. It is designed to provide a small, flexible, and highly efficient power management solution for a wide range of portable devices.
Key Features
- Input Voltage Range: The device supports an input voltage range of 2.25V to 5.5V, making it suitable for single-cell Li-Ion batteries, as well as 3.3V or 5V input rails.
- Adjustable Output Voltage: The output voltage can be adjusted from 0.8V to Vin, allowing for a wide range of output voltage settings to cater to various application requirements.
- High Efficiency: With up to 95% efficiency, the TPS62510DRC is designed to maximize battery life and reduce power loss due to heat.
- Low Quiescent Current: The low quiescent current of only 20µA (typical) during operation and 1µA in shutdown mode contributes to the extended battery life of the end application.
- Small Package: The device comes in a compact 3x3 mm2 10-pin SON package, making it ideal for space-constrained applications.
- Integrated MOSFETs: The TPS62510DRC includes integrated high-side and low-side MOSFET switches, which eliminates the need for external FETs and simplifies the design.
